Step 1 – Determine Your Budget and Financing Options

Assess Your Budget

And in case you intend on taking a loan, you can do some research and identify a bank and other financial institutions that provide home loans on the acquisition of 3 BHK flats in Kudasan. Approval by most banks comes at a CIBIL score of 700+. Knowing the rate of interest, duration of the loan, and the processing fees may enable you to choose the cheapest financing source and calculate the EMIs. The point behind comparing various banks is to make sure that you get the best interest rate and flexibility of payment which is suited according to your financial needs.

Calculate Total Cost

Estimate outflow monthly using online calculators of EMI. Consider indirect expenses like the cost of parking, upkeep of society, and property tax. This will make sure that you will not have to be surprised about the financial issues in the future and you will be able to comfortably handle your expenses. Estimating total cost upfront will also enable you to plan on the interiors and furniture and other expenses in the movement within the business.

Step 4 – Verify Legal Documents

Essential Property Documents

Prior to a closing an agreement, review the documents of the property:

  • Sale deed
  • Title deed
  • Occupancy certificate
  • RERA registration
  • Encumbrance certificate

Checking of such documents assists in the safeguarding of your investment and legal hassles that may arise ahead. Red flagging is done to make sure that nothing is amiss with the ownership or concealed debts relating to the property.

Avoiding Common Pitfalls

Check on the outstanding dues or law suits. Ensure that the builder has received all the approvals needed and the schedule of the possession is within your expectations. It is easier to avoid such pitfalls and save money and stress. It also guarantees that you will not have to make delays or challenges throughout the registration and possession process.

Step 5 – Negotiate and Finalize the Deal

Pricing Negotiation Tips

Negotiation is key. Bargain on price and amount of booking and other charges using your market research. Discounts are also usually offered by the builders on the ready to move flats or also on the festive seasons and a wise bargain could help you a lot. You can also negotiate extras such as getting parking, access to clubhouse or discounts on maintaining the property, during the process of acquiring the property which usually improves on your value of purchasing the property.

Booking and Agreement

After agreeing on the price, pay the booking advance and the agreement has to be reviewed. Make sure that every detail, payment date, possession date, and a penalty on not taking possession should be clearly stated so that there will be no misunderstanding in the future. Obtaining a lawyer who will check the agreement may also guard against interests and making out of the legal requirements clear.

Registration and Handover

Register your name at the local sub-registrar office. Make sure that the legal papers are signed, the property is put on record before being handed over. This is the last stage that makes you a homeowner and now begins your home ownership life. Gathering all the keys, utility connections, and the membership papers of the society guarantees you a successful move into your new house.

Understanding Property Taxes, Stamp Duty, and Other Charges

The purchase of a 3 BHK flat in Kudasan comes accompanied with a number of taxes and charges that one ought to have an idea about. These are stamp duty, registration fees and any other government duties that would be applicable in Gujarat which may enhance the overall cost substantially. Also, there are recurrent costs associated with the properties such as maintenance fees, society fee, and power bills, which you must be able to include in the monthly budget. Most purchasers tend to ignore the expenses that go unnoticed like car parking, club membership, or interior work. Preparing in advance and estimating this money will make sure that you do not exceed your budget and you do not experience any economic shocks. Having a record of all charges is also useful with regard to budgeting in the long run, and proper management of the property.
